WebApr 11, 2024 · Pyramid pose can be done with modifications 2.5+ months post-op. Make sure you have blocks or something to support you on both sides of your leg, and keep your knee bent. Don’t fully straighten the leg in this posture so early on in your recovery, as it will put too much pressure on the knee joint. WebThe other option is propping Balasana to decrease the amount of flexion in the knee. Place any cushion or blanket underneath the buttocks, on top of the heels. If ankles are uncomfortable place a roll underneath them with the rest of the blanket under the knees if possible. The face can rest on hands, fists, or forearms. WebYoga After Knee Replacement. WebIt is performed primarily to relieve knee pain and stiffness caused by osteoarthritis. Most people who get this surgery have advanced knee arthritis, in which the knee cartilage is worn away and the surface of the knee becomes pitted, eroded, and uneven.
